The butterfly (DIN) heads were developed for broadcast so the studios wouldn't have to change out headblocs every time they switched from stereo to mono tapes! This is a non-starter if you want the best stereo playback!
I now have an A80 headblock with butterfly heads just for recording and playing for fun - for playback of the Tapeproject tapes I use the standard heads.
